A righteous version of the classic original!
The Telecaster is an undeniable force in all styles of guitar-based American music and the Fender American Deluxe Telecaster Electric Guitar is the top of the Tele chain! It offers stunningly accurate noiseless vintage sounds through 2 SCN (Samarium Cobalt Noiseless) pickups, as well as new variations through the versatile S-1 switching system. Its highly detailed fret and nut work make it incredibly easy to play. Other features include a bound-top alder body with a comfortably contoured back, abalone dot inlays, and aged plastic parts. Includes Fender hardshell case.
Samarium Cobalt Noiseless pickups
It's no secret that pickup designers have been striving to develop the ultimate noise-free single-coil replacement pickup. In pursuit of as little 60-cycle hum and extraneous noise as possible and the classic bell-like tones and fidelity of the original Fender designs, Fender has poured their energy into discovering a new world-class pickup for the ages. With open minds and a willingness to seemingly question everything, Fender partnered with legendary pickup designer Bill Lawrence. The pickup that was birthed from this extraordinary partnership is the Samarium Cobalt Noiseless pickup. It has no hum, no microphonics, close to zero magnetic interruption of the string path, and the widest sonic parameters possible - from Fender classic single coils to tones not yet imagined. Truly a revolutionary design in guitar pickups.
Fender American Deluxe Series Telecaster Electric Guitar Features:
- Premium bound alder body
- Deluxe modern C-shaped neck shape with satin finish and comfortable, hand-rolled edges
- Stainless steel bridge with chrome-plated brass saddles
- 2 Fender SCN (Samarium Cobalt Noiseless)
- S-1 switching system
- Fender/Schaller deluxe staggered cast/sealed tuning machines
- Classic knurled chrome knobs
- Abalone dot position inlays
- Bound top
- Contoured back
- Highly detailed fret and nut work
- 22 medium-jumbo frets
- Schaller strap-lock ready
Fender American Deluxe Series Telecaster Electric Guitar Specifications:| Body Type | Solid Body | | Body Wood | Alder. | | Bridge Pickup | Samarium Cobalt Noiseless | | Bridge Type | Tele with Brass Saddles | | Controls | Volume with S-1 Switch,Tone | | Finish | Polyurethane | | Fretboard | Rosewood or Maple | | Fretboard Radius | 9 1/2" (241 mm) | | Hardware Color | Chrome | | Middle Pickup | Samarium Cobalt Noiseless | | Neck Joint | Bolt-on | | Neck Pickup | Samarium Cobalt Noiseless | | Neck Shape | C-Shape | | Neck Wood | Maple | | Number Of Frets | 22 | | Number of Strings | 6 | | Nut Width | 1.6875" (43 mm) | | Pickup Configuration | Single-Single-Single | | Pickup Selector | 3-way | | Scale Length | 25 1/2" (648 mm) | | Tremolo | No | | Tuners | Fender/Schaller | | With Case | Hardshell |

Why look elsewhere?
A remarkable instrument by any standard, the Fender American Deluxe Series Telecaster is a versatile, extremely well-made, and terrific sounding guitar. I own (and regularly play) a wide variety of guitars (Gibson, Hofner, Gretsch, PRS, Guild, Hamer, and a few you have probably never heard of), but this Tele has become my "go-to" guitar, especially when I'm laying down demo tracks, writing new songs, or just noodling around. The build is by far the best I've seen on a Fender for quite a while: the fret work is excellent, the finish is extremely good, and the factory set-up was, well, impeccable. Kudos to Fender and Bill Lawrence for their Samarium Cobalt pick-ups, which truly are free of that annoying 60-cycle hum. I suspect that Fender has upgraded the original SC pickups, since those on my guitar produce a wider range of tones and textures than I expected - and have a lot of punch. With the right amp (and, of course, the right effects) there isn't too much you can't do with this guitar. If you think that Teles are for Country players only, think again. At the very least, go to your local music store and try one. I think you'll be pleased that you did; and, who knows, you might become a dedicated "Tele-head". Highly recommended.
